76MM Turbo Supra Vs 150 Shot COBRA!

Cobra on the streets with the almighty 2jz!

          Cobra got hurt over and over by the supra! Big single turbo supra vs 150 shot COBRA is an awesome match up. The power levels on the two cars must be close but the supra shows its superiority and just walks away. Maybe a Zo6 would be a better match up for the Japanese powerhouse 😉

Screen Shot 2016-09-03 at 12.51.15 AM

Posted in

Street Racing

Video Duration: